The old man put his foot in the stirrup

And presently he got astride;

He put the thief’s horse to the gallop,

You need not bid the old man ride.

9

‘Nay, stay! nay, stay!’ says the thief,

‘And half the money thou shalt have;’

‘Nay, by my troth,’ says the old man,

‘For once I have cheated a knave.’
